摘 要:【目的】为进一步揭示"东桑西移"项目在推进我国蚕桑产业供给侧结构性改革中的作用。【方法】本研究以"东桑西移"项目实施前后10年(1996-2016年)各省桑园面积为研究对象,结合1999-2016年各省的自然、社会、经济等数据,通过空间分析及数理统计,探索了我国桑园面积变化的空间结构特征及其驱动力。【结果】①2006年开始实施"东桑西移"项目后,我国东部桑园面积呈线性减少,平均每年减少16482.81 hm^2,十年间的动态度为-4.94%;西部桑园面积呈线性增加,年约增加桑园面积7924.69 hm^2,十年间的动态度为1.96%。②空间重心转移模型显示,我国桑园面积空间分布重心在1996-2016年间由北向南移动的整个过程,且明显具有向西南偏移的趋势。③主成分分析-逐步回归分析模型(Y=6.670x_1-6.977x_6+134.667x_7-1.692x_(12))明确指出,自然、人口和经济三大类4种驱动因子对我国桑园面积(Y)的时空变化有显著的指示作用。其中,自然类驱动因子主要指降雨量;人口类驱动因子主要包括15~64岁人口数量和65岁及以上人口数量两个指标,经济类驱动因子主要是指第二产业生产总值。【结论】综上可知,在政策引导、自然条件、人口结构和经济发展的复合驱动下,我国桑园面积时空格局变迁明显。【Objective】The present paper aimed to study how the project named‘Sericulture Moving from East to West’affect the supply-side structural reform of the sericulture industry.【Method】the changes of mulberry fields in different provinces 10 years before and after the implementation of the policy(from 1996 to 2016)were analyzed.Also,combined with natural,social,economic data from 1999 to 2016,this paper explored spatial structure characteristics and driven forces of mulberry area changes using spatial analysis and mathematical statis-tics.【Result】(i)The area of mulberry fields in the eastern China decreased linearly,16482.81 ha every year,with-4.94%since dy-namic degree,since 2006 the year implementing moving sericulture production area from the east to west policy,while the area of mulberry fields increased linearly,with 7924.69 ha every year and 1.96%dynamic degree in ten years;(ii)The spatial model revealed that from 1996 to 2016,the center of mulberry field transferred from north to south,with a clear trend of diverting to the southwestern part of China;(iii)Principal component analysis and stepwise regression analysis demonstrated that natural,population and economy,as three major driv-ing forces had significant impact on the area change of mulberry fields.Here,natural factor was the annual rainfall.Population factor includ-ed the number of people aged from 15 to 64,and the number of people old than 65.Economic factor was the value of secondary industry.【Conclusion】Under the combined driving of policy guidance,natural conditions,population structure and economic development,the spatial and temporal pattern of mulberry plantation area in China has changed significantly.
